高效接收:从服务器获取数据的秘诀

资源类型:00-9.net 2025-01-12 12:48

从服务器接受数据简介:



从服务器接受数据的艺术与科学:构建高效、安全的数据交互体系 在当今这个数字化时代,数据已成为企业运营、决策制定和智能技术发展的核心驱动力

    从服务器接受数据,这一看似简单的技术动作,实则蕴含着复杂的技术逻辑、严谨的安全考量以及高效的数据处理能力

    它不仅是信息技术领域的一项基础任务,更是推动企业数字化转型、实现智能化升级的关键环节

    本文将深入探讨从服务器接受数据的全过程,涵盖数据请求、传输、接收、处理及安全等多个维度,旨在构建一套高效、安全的数据交互体系

     一、数据请求:精准定位,高效启动 从服务器接受数据的起点,往往始于一个明确的数据请求

    这个请求通常由客户端(如应用程序、用户设备或后台服务)发起,旨在从特定的服务器或数据库中检索所需的信息

    一个精准的数据请求能够显著提升数据交互的效率与准确性,减少不必要的数据传输和处理开销

     1. 明确需求:首先,必须清晰界定所需数据的类型、范围、格式以及时效性要求

    这要求数据请求者具备深厚的业务理解和数据分析能力,能够准确识别并表达数据需求

     2. API设计:现代应用中,API(应用程序编程接口)是数据请求的主要通道

    设计良好的API应具备易用性、高效性和可扩展性,能够支持多种请求方式(如GET、POST)、参数传递、认证机制及错误处理,确保数据请求能够顺利执行

     3. 缓存策略:为了减少重复请求带来的负担,合理利用缓存技术至关重要

    通过缓存频繁访问的数据,可以有效降低服务器负载,提升响应速度

     二、数据传输:优化协议,保障速度与安全 数据请求一旦发出,接下来的任务便是确保数据能够安全、快速地穿越网络,从服务器传输到客户端

    这一过程涉及多种网络协议、数据传输技术和安全机制的选择与优化

     1. 传输协议:HTTP/HTTPS是当前互联网中最常用的数据传输协议

    HTTP提供了基本的数据传输功能,而HTTPS则在此基础上增加了SSL/TLS加密层,确保数据在传输过程中的保密性和完整性

    对于敏感数据的传输,HTTPS是不可或缺的选择

     2. 数据压缩:为了减少网络带宽占用,提高传输效率,数据压缩技术被广泛采用

    如Gzip、Brotli等压缩算法,可以在不影响数据可读性的前提下,显著减小数据包大小,加快传输速度

     3. 负载均衡与CDN:对于大型系统而言,负载均衡器可以分配请求到多个服务器,实现请求的分散处理,避免单点过载

    而内容分发网络(CDN)则通过在全球分布的数据中心缓存内容,进一步缩短用户与数据之间的距离,加速数据传输

     三、数据接收:精确解析,高效存储 当数据顺利到达客户端,接下来的挑战在于如何准确解析接收到的数据,并将其高效存储或处理

    这一步骤直接关乎数据的质量和利用效率

     1. 数据解析:根据事先约定的数据格式(如JSON、XML、CSV等),客户端需要解析接收到的数据,将其转化为应用程序可识别的数据结构

    高效的解析算法和库能够大大加快这一过程

     2. 数据校验:接收到的数据应经过严格的校验,确保其完整性、准确性和一致性

    这包括检查数据格式、字段值范围、必填项是否缺失等,以防止错误数据对后续处理造成干扰

     3. 存储策略:数据的存储方式应根据其使用场景和生命周期灵活选择

    关系型数据库(如MySQL)、非关系型数据库(如MongoDB)、分布式文件系统(如Hadoop HDFS)或内存数据库(如Redis)等,各有优劣,需结合实际需求进行配置

     四、数据处理:挖掘价值,驱动决策 数据的真正价值在于其被有效处理和利用

    从服务器接受的数据,经过清洗、整合、分析后,可以转化为有价值的信息和知识,支持业务决策和创新

     1. 数据清洗:去除重复、错误或无关的数据,填补缺失值,确保数据质量

    这是数据分析前不可或缺的一步

     2. 数据整合:将来自不同源、不同格式的数据进行整合,形成统一的数据视图,便于后续分析

     3. 数据分析与挖掘:运用统计学方法、机器学习算法等技术,从数据中提取有价值的信息和模式,为业务决策提供依据

     4. 可视化呈现:通过图表、仪表盘等形式,直观展示数据分析结果,帮助非技术人员更好地理解数据,促进跨部门沟通与合作

     五、安全考量:全方位防护,确保数据无忧 在数据交互的整个生命周期中,安全性始终是一个不可忽视的问题

    从服务器接受数据,必须采取一系列安全措施,确保数据不被泄露、篡改或滥用

     1. 加密技术:无论是数据传输过程中的SSL/TLS加密,还是数据存储时的AES加密,都是保护数据安全的基本手段

     2. 访问控制:通过身份认证(如OAuth2、JWT)、权限管理(RBAC、ABAC)等机制,严格控制数据的访问权限,防止未经授权的访问

     3. 监控与审计:建立全面的日志记录和监控体系,及时发现并响应安全事件

    同时,定期进行安全审计,评估并改进系统的安全状况

     4. 数据脱敏与匿名化:对于敏感数据,在不影响分析效果的前提下,通过脱敏或匿名化处理,减少数据泄露的风险

     结语

阅读全文
上一篇:泰兴SEO公司推荐:哪家服务更优?

最新收录:

  • 高效指南:如何从服务器轻松拷贝文件
  • 服务器间互联:从一台到另一台的桥梁
  • 服务器间高效连接指南
  • 一键操作:轻松从服务器删除多余文件
  • 一键操作:从服务器删除指定文件夹教程
  • 一键下载:服务器文件到本地秒传技巧
  • 服务器传文件至本地,速度如何?
  • 高效技巧:一键下载服务器文件到本地
  • 一键下载:轻松从服务器获取精美图片
  • 一键下载:服务器文件到本地速取秘籍
  • 下载压缩文件失败?服务器连接难题解析
  • 从服务器移除:高效管理数据的秘诀
  • 首页 | 从服务器接受数据:高效接收:从服务器获取数据的秘诀